Output 3ab81b3432cfbfa69ae0449ec066e1541e9cabcdf07adbfa7c3312552eb29849:0

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c668c511000124dd6bd30082c38b91b54c4e956 OP_EQUALVERIFY OP_CHECKSIG
address
17xyCkKNX4GCZyWUaz6v6N2zo6xn2Y75hc
transaction
3ab81b3432cfbfa69ae0449ec066e1541e9cabcdf07adbfa7c3312552eb29849
spent
true